Relishing a Traditional Balinese breakfast Experience



Embracing a traditional Indonesian breakfast is a crucial part of your Ubud trip. In contrast to Western breakfasts, the local food provides a unique mix of sugary and savory flavors. A typical breakfast includes meals like Nasi Goreng or Mie Goreng, which are tasty rice dishes or noodles. Alternatively, you might enjoy a tasty bowl of Bubur Ayam, a rich chicken porridge. Don't forget to try some of the incredible local produce.


  • Trying authentic Nasi Goreng or Mie Goreng.

  • Tasting a comforting bowl of Bubur Ayam (chicken porridge).

  • Drinking on a cold coconut water.

  • Exploring local tropical fruits such as mangosteen or rambutan.

  • Locating quaint warungs that offer a genuinely native breakfast experience.


These simple dishes are a testament to the vibrancy of Balinese food culture. Savoring a local breakfast links you with the soul of Bali.

Feature Local Warung Modern Cafe
Ambiance Local, unassuming, usually open-air Trendy, comfortable, air-conditioned with modern decor
Menu Specializes in local Balinese and Indonesian dishes Diverse of international options, such as smoothie bowls and pancakes
Price Very affordable, great value for money More expensive, reflecting premium ingredients and ambiance
Experience Authentic, immerses you in local life and cuisine Casual, social, perfect for travelers and digital nomads

Frequently Asked Questions about Breakfast in Ubud



  • Q: What is the best time to get breakfast in Bali?

    A: The best time for breakfast is typically between 8 AM and 10 AM. Within this time, the weather is nicely cool and most eateries are fully open. Nevertheless, many places offer breakfast throughout the day.

  • Q: Are there plant-based and vegan options for breakfast ubud?

    A: Yes, Bali is well-known for its health-conscious and vegan food scene. You will find a wide variety of cafes offering tasty and creative vegetarian and non-meat breakfast ubud dishes.

  • Q: How much does a average breakfast restaurant cost in Ubud?

    A: The cost of a breakfast restaurant in Bali can differ significantly. A local warung might cost as low as 20,000 IDR, whereas a meal at a international cafe could range from 50,000 IDR to 150,000 IDR or higher.
